Yes, cold rooms and freezer rooms typically require sprinklers, but the specific need depends on local fire codes and regulations. These areas may present unique challenges for fire suppression due to low temperatures that can affect sprinkler functionality. In some cases, specialized sprinkler systems, such as dry pipe or pre-action systems, may be necessary to prevent freezing. It's essential to consult with fire safety professionals and adhere to local building codes for the best solution.

A system which is networked with extinguishing and detection devices to ensure that the danger of fire is low. Smoke/Heat detectors, sirens, bells, sounders and call points are in place to detect any fire and alert you if there is the need to evacuate. A person can manually activate the call point if they discover a fire. When the fire alarm sounds, extinguishing apperatus such as sprinklers, CO2 gas release will activate, in order to quickly put the fire to a halt.
